Output 18712fe3e88a68a06a425f4bd1197bbcc0353b1c894f6178f294248a63f27c27:3

value
38892535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38bf3478d16bac949bf288f556d442ef4c5fbaa8 OP_EQUAL
address
MD5D8KueBfibtYHJprXRtg46vsK1UU5ppe
transaction
18712fe3e88a68a06a425f4bd1197bbcc0353b1c894f6178f294248a63f27c27
spent
true